Ralf Herbrich (born May 11, 1974 in Schwedt / Oder ) is a German computer scientist .

Life

After graduating from high school in 1992, Herbrich studied computer science at the Technical University of Berlin , where he received his doctorate in 2000 on the subject of "Learning Linear Classifiers: Theory and Algorithms".

From 2000 to 2011 Herbrich worked at Microsoft in England, most recently as director of the “Future Social Experiences (FUSE) Lab”, then from 2011 to 2012 as engineering manager at Facebook in the USA .

From 2013 to 2019 he was Managing Director of Amazon's Development Center Germany in Berlin . Since 2020 he has been Senior Vice President Data Science & Machine Learning at Zalando.

Publications

  • Ralf Herbrich. Learning Kernel Classifiers: Theory and Algorithms. MIT Press, 2002
